Daily activities include:
Representing clients in the FCFCOA
Conducting mediations and collaborations
Drafting legal documents and correspondence
Providing legal advice and practical solutions
Offering clients realistic, tailored advice designed to reduce conflict rather than escalate it

What We Offer
We aim to create a work environment that reflects what we provide to our clients—safety, security, and the opportunity to thrive.
✔ Effective and supportive supervision and mentorship to foster a rewarding, sustainable career
✔ Training in trauma-informed, family violence-aware, and neuro-affirming practice
✔ A learning and professional development budget
✔ The opportunity to work with experienced, award-winning lawyers who are sector leaders
✔ Regular reflective practice sessions with an external practitioner, as part of our trauma-informed commitment
✔ No 6-minute increment billing—realistic billable targets instead
✔ Flexible work-from-home options for non-client-facing days
We are open to both part-time (four days per week) and full-time arrangements, offering a salary range of $90,000 - $130,000 per annum (depending on experience, pro-rata) plus 11.5% superannuation.
